A 26-year-old suspect was arrested by the Serious Organised Crime Investigation (SOCI) Kidnapping task team of the Hawks in a joint operation with Mdantsane Tactical Response Team (TRT) on 13 October 2023 for kidnapping charges.

According to police spokesperson, Warrant-Officer Ndiphiwe Mhlakuvana, the suspect was arrested after the information of a foreign national who was kidnapped on 17 July at his shop in the Dordrecht area in the Eastern Cape was received.

“The allegations revealed that the victim was accosted by four armed unknown men who allegedly pointed him with a firearm and forced him to a gold Toyota Avanza.

“Further allegation exposed that the victim was kidnapped, however, was kept for few days by kidnappers, who demanded his cash, bank cards and his PIN,” said Ndiphiwe Mhlakuvana.

Ndiphiwe Mhlakuvana added, “The suspects allegedly withdrew an amount of R8000 from the victim’s bank account using his card. Moreover, the allegations further exposed that the suspect bought some expensive clothes worth R27 000. The cash, clothes and the vehicle were seized for further investigation.”

“The investigation divulged that through video footage, the suspect was identified and linked to the kidnapping. The joint team traced the suspect and arrested them on 13 October 2023.”

The suspect will first appear at Dordrecht Magistrates’ Court on 16 October 2023.

The Provincial Head, Major General Obed Ngwenya, is much-admired by the joint team effort to swiftly apprehend the accused person to face the rule of law.
